![]() http://www.ardesa.com/detalles.php?w...l=433&wbrand=2 Ardesa of Spain still makes a .58 caliber blunderbuss which is one of the only factory percussion models that I've ever seen available. But at a cost of about $500-$600+ they're fairly expensive. But as far as payloads go, any 12 gauge shotgun could propel a larger load of shot or buck shot. It's just a smoothbore with a short barrel and a cylinder choke. The loading funnel does make it look cool and faster to reload, while the short barrel makes it awfully handy for brush hunting.
